Time to break the anchor with 23/18(2) and 13/3. Opponent leaves a shot on 19 numbers and there's some future jeopardy when White covers the 11-point with 54,44,43,42,41, or 31. Keeping the 23-point anchor loses more g's and wins fewer games.
